Connecting Virtual To Real Via Mobile

  • Comments Comments (View)
  • Text Size: A A

The BBC has a piece on Web 2.0 and how it works with mobile phones—mobile blogging and so on. It quotes Newbay’s chief executive Paddy Holahan as saying that “mobile tends to be much more about your lifestyle; internet blogging tends to be much more about your opinions, politics, things like that”.
It goes on to talk about IBM’s space in virtual game Second Life, and what it hopes to achieve… “IBM’s master inventor Zygmunt Lozinski explained his vision does not simply involve accessing Second Life from your phone - it involves using your mobile as a bridge between the virtual world and the real world.” The idea being that if someone tries to contact you when you’re not online you can have it sent to your mobile phone, record a video and play that back to the person in the game. Which is weird… if you’re going to look at what can happen, why not just do the video call real time? Or if the image is a problem, just do voice…
